Hi Ann & John! I wish I'd have seen your condo yesterday with regard to the hair loss. Shnookie started having a reaction to Frontline several months ago. His hair would fall out and the skin underneath would get scabby. I asked the vet about it and they called Frontline CS, who did say it is sometimes a side effect. Shnookie is now 7 yrs old, and been on Frontline all his life with no problems until recently. I wonder if they changed the formula? Anyway, I switched him to Revolution, and the first month on that, he had the hair loss again, but no scabs or irritation of any kind on the skin. I decided we could live with that, but it only happened the first application. He's had it twice more since then and no reaction at all. So maybe try Revolution. It costs I think about $1 more per 3 month package, but it's well worth it.

Frustrated that they seemed to be back in 2 weeks and i was worried about repeating the treatment that soon. The vet suggested switching medications around, Advantage - yes, Advantix- NO (it has pyrethrums), didn't mention Revolution. Also said that Frontline Plus can be reapplied at 3 weeks, good to know. Thank goodness no sign of fungus (ringworm!)!

Tess had similar hairloss before, but not so long after the treatment.

DH vacuumed thouroughly and sprayed everything down w/ Zodiac. We kept Tess in the guest room out in the garage until everything was dry.

Does Tess go outside? I have problems with 2 of mine getting bitten after the 2 week mark as well, and the vet told me that was due to the environment then. All those once a month flea treatments take 12 hrs to kill a flea once it gets on the animal.
